John Greensmith (d. Dec 10, 1936)

A widower at the time he married Sarah, he was a shepherd from Cornwall. Having arrived in Australia in 1891, he and Sarah evidently separated, for there is no record of their divorce. He apparently took their youngest child, Edith, with him. It was initially thought that John died at Hughenden, 110km east of Richmond, bin 1893, but he actually died at Charters Towers in 1936. After separating from Sarah he lived with a woman by the name of Clara Marsland, who he called his wife, although there is no record of their marriage. However, he and Clara had three children, Sarah Jane (b 1895), Robert Henry (bc 1897) and John David (bc 1899).
